4-Day Itinerary for Goa in July 2023

  1. Day 1: Explore Old Goa
    30 minutes (12.8 km) from Panaji

    Begin your trip by exploring the historical city of Old Goa, which was once the capital of Portuguese India. Visit the UNESCO World Heritage sites of Basilica of Bom Jesus, a 16th-century church that holds the mortal remains of St. Francis Xavier, and Se Cathedral, one of the largest churches in Asia. Stroll around the beautiful churches, chapels, and convents in the area, and admire the Portuguese-inspired architecture. You can also visit the Museum of Christian Art to learn more about the Christian art and artifacts of Goa. End your day with a sunset walk at Miramar Beach, which is just a short drive away.

  2. Day 2: Dudhsagar Waterfalls and Spice Plantations
    2 hours (70.2 km) from Old Goa

    Today, head out to the majestic Dudhsagar Waterfalls, which are located on the Mandovi River. These tiered waterfalls are one of the highest in India and a sight to behold. You can trek to the waterfalls or hire a jeep or bike to get there. After taking a dip in the cool waters, visit the spice plantations nearby to learn about the different spices and herbs grown in Goa. Take a guided tour of the plantations, and enjoy a traditional Goan meal with freshly made spice blends.

  3. Day 3: Beach Hopping in North Goa
    1 hour (17.7 km) from Old Goa

    North Goa is a beach lover's paradise with its pristine beaches and lively shacks. Start with a visit to Baga Beach, a popular spot for water sports and nightlife. Next, head to Anjuna Beach, which is known for its flea market and hippie culture. Relax at Vagator Beach, which has stunning red cliffs and a relaxed vibe. Finally, end your day at Calangute Beach, which is one of the most popular beaches in Goa and has a wide range of dining and shopping options.

  4. Day 4: Fort Aguada and Panaji City
    30 minutes (15.6 km) from Calangute Beach

    On your last day, visit Fort Aguada, a 17th-century Portuguese fort that offers stunning views of the Arabian Sea. Explore the fort's lighthouse, prison, and secret escape tunnel. Next, head to Panaji City, the capital of Goa. Visit the Baroque-style Our Lady of the Immaculate Conception Church, which is one of the oldest churches in Goa. Walk around the Latin Quarter of Fontainhas to see the colorful Portuguese-style houses and enjoy some traditional Goan cuisine at the local restaurants. End your day with a sunset cruise along the Mandovi River, where you can enjoy some live music and dance performances.

Time and Costs Estimates

  • Basilica of Bom Jesus (1-2 hours, free)
  • Se Cathedral (1-2 hours, free)
  • Miramar Beach (1-2 hours, free)
  • Dudhsagar Waterfalls (4-5 hours, INR 400 per person)
  • Spice Plantations (2-3 hours, INR 500 per person)
  • Baga Beach (2-3 hours, free)
  • Anjuna Beach (2-3 hours, free)
  • Vagator Beach (2-3 hours, free)
  • Calangute Beach (2-3 hours, free)
  • Fort Aguada (1-2 hours, INR 25 per person)
  • Our Lady of the Immaculate Conception Church (1-2 hours, free)
  • Fontainhas (1-2 hours, free)
  • Sunset Cruise (1-2 hours, INR 300 per person)
  • Total Estimated Costs: INR 1225 per person
